A Professional Certificate in Conflict Resolution for Customer Support equips you with the essential skills to effectively manage and resolve customer conflicts. This program focuses on developing your communication, negotiation, and mediation abilities, crucial for maintaining positive customer relationships and improving customer satisfaction.
Learning outcomes include mastering de-escalation techniques, understanding diverse communication styles, and implementing conflict resolution strategies within a customer support environment. You'll learn to identify the root causes of conflict, empathize with customer concerns, and find mutually beneficial solutions. Effective complaint handling and building rapport are key components.
The program's duration typically ranges from several weeks to a few months, depending on the chosen format (online, in-person, or blended learning). This flexible timeframe allows professionals to balance their learning with their existing commitments. Self-paced learning options may be available.
